Windshield washer relay question


Susan --

The washers don't exactly have a relay -- the wiper stalk switches (including the pushbutton for the wagon) connect directly to the washer pumps. However, in both cases, the same signal that goes to the pumps ALSO connects to the wiper relays. This triggers the wipers to automatically provide several sweeps.

The wiper relays are located behind a metal plate, driver's side floor, very front-left, about where a tall driver's left foor might rest. If you pull down the top of the carpet you'll see several harnesses disappearing behind a sheet metal panel (very left side). This panel is about 4-5" wide. Pull up the harnesses and you'll see the two relays wrapped in plastic foam. Black for the front, white for the rear unless you have a GL with intermittent sweep (rear), then it's blue instead of white. At least I think those are the colors.....

For troubleshooting, I'd check the fuse and then check right at the washer pumps with a test light to look for 12 volts when the switch is activated.

It's unlikely that the stalk switches have both failed, but the pumps are possible culprits.
